Hertha BSC vs. VfL Bochum: Hertha Wins 2. Bundesliga Opener Amid Fan Banner Interruption

Hertha BSC opened the new 2. Bundesliga season with a victory against VfL Bochum in a fixture that was temporarily halted due to a fan banner displayed in the stands. According to match reports from the league’s opening weekend, the capital club secured the result under challenging circumstances as supporters briefly interrupted the rhythm of the encounter.

Match Opening and First-Half Interruptions

The campaign opener began with high intensity before match officials paused proceedings during the first half. According to verified accounts from the venue, the stoppage occurred because a large fan banner obstructed visibility and safety zones, forcing referees to halt play temporarily until the display was removed. Once the pitch was cleared, players resumed action under the watchful eyes of the officiating crew, managing the unexpected delay without losing their competitive focus.

How Hertha Secured the Result

Hertha capitalized on key tactical moments to edge past Bochum as the match unfolded. Technical staff from both sides adjusted their setups following the mid-game disruption, but the capital side found the decisive openings required to control the tempo. Match statistics and reporters on the ground noted that Hertha’s disciplined defensive shape blunted Bochum’s late attempts to equalize, allowing the visitors to seal the three points.

Standings Implications and Early Season Momentum

Opening matchday victories carry significant psychological weight in the fiercely competitive 2. Bundesliga promotion race. Securing an away or opening win sets an immediate benchmark for the squad under management. Analysts following the German second division point out that early consistency often separates promotion contenders from mid-table sides over a grueling 34-game schedule.
